Abstract

A level wound coil (LWC) mounted on pallet having; an LWC having a plurality of coil layers each of which has a pipe wound in alignment winding and in traverse winding; and a pallet on which the one or more LWC is mounted or on which the one or more LWC is mounted through a cushioning material. The LWC has a shift section where the pipe is shifted from the m-th coil layer to the (m+1)-th coil layer on a bottom surface thereof when the LWC is disposed on the mount surface. A start point of a (k+1)-th shift section does not transit, relative to a start point of a k-th shift section, in a reverse direction to a winding direction of the pipe. The pallet or the cushioning material has a recessed area that is formed at all or a part of a portion of the pallet or the cushioning material to face the (k+1)-th shift section not transiting in the reverse direction.
